Printhead and inkjet printing apparatus

By integrating a printing module and a cutting module into an inkjet printer, the printhead achieves pattern printing and material segmentation functions, solving the problem of manual cutting required in existing technologies and improving the practicality and convenience of the printhead.

AI Technical Summary

Technical Problem

Existing inkjet printing devices only have inkjet printing functionality in their printheads and cannot automatically cut the printed material, requiring manual cutting, which is inconvenient to use.

Method used

The printing module and the cutting module are integrated into the housing. The printing module is used for pattern printing, and the cutting module is used for material cutting. The extension and retraction of the cutting assembly is realized by the drive mechanism. The print head integrated into the housing has both pattern printing and material cutting functions.

Benefits of technology

It improves the practicality of the printhead, reduces the size of the inkjet printing device, enables automatic cutting of printing materials, and enhances ease of use.

Abstract

The utility model discloses a printing head and an ink-jet printing device, and relates to the technical field of printing, the printing head comprises a casing, a printing module and a cutter module, an accommodating cavity is formed in the casing, the casing is provided with a working surface, and the working surface is provided with a first passing port communicated with the accommodating cavity; the printing module is arranged in the containing cavity and is opposite to the first passing opening so that the printing module can be exposed through the first passing opening. The cutter module is arranged on the machine shell and can protrude out of the working face so as to cut the printing material. According to the technical scheme, the printing head integrated with the cutter module can be provided, so that the practicability of the printing head is improved.

[0066] In the related art, the inkjet printing device can print patterns on the printing material through the print head, so that the part of the printing material can be laid on the fabric, and the pattern is transferred to the surface of the fabric by using the heat transfer process. However, the print head in the current inkjet printing device usually only has the inkjet printing function, and cannot automatically cut the printing material according to the size of the printing pattern. After completing the pattern printing on the printing material, the printing material needs to be transferred to the outside of the inkjet printing device for cutting processing, which is inconvenient to use.

[0067] Therefore, based on the above consideration, the present application provides a print head 100. The print head 100 comprises a shell 10, a print module 20 and a cutter module 30. The print module 20 and the cutter module 30 are integrated in the shell 10, so that the print head 100 has the functions of pattern printing and printing material cutting, which is beneficial to improve the practicability of the print head 100.

[0074] Please refer to Figures 1 to 5In the embodiment of the utility model, the cutter module 30 includes a driving mechanism 31 and a cutter assembly 32, the driving mechanism 31 is arranged in the accommodating cavity;The cutter assembly 32 is in transmission connection with the driving mechanism 31, so that the cutter assembly 32 can move relative to the second opening 1111a;The cutter assembly 32 has a working state and a storage state, when in the working state, the cutter assembly 32 at least partially extends out of the second opening 1111a, when in the storage state, the cutter assembly 32 is retracted to the accommodating cavity.

[0075] Need to explain, inkjet printing device includes the driving device arranged in the outside of print head 100, and print head 100 can be in transmission connection with the driving device.In use, print head 100 can be moved relative to the printing material under the drive of the driving device, to move to the corresponding position of printing material, and be printed with the printing module 20 or cutter module 30 respectively to the printing material pattern printing and printing material segmentation.

[0076] When the pattern printing step is carried out, the working surface 1111 of print head 100 is arranged opposite to the printing material in the vertical direction, and the printing module 20 can be used to print the printing material below, and the cutter module 30 can be movably arranged relative to the second opening 1111b.Therefore, when print head 100 carries out the pattern printing step, the cutter assembly 32 can be kept in the storage state of retracting to the accommodating cavity, so as to avoid that the cutter 322 causes damage to the printing material in the process of moving printing, and affects the processing effect of print head 100.

[0077] After completing the pattern printing step of the printing material, the printing module 20 stops inkjet printing on the printing material, and the cutter assembly 32 is switched to the working state of at least partially extending out of the second opening 1111b, so that the cutter assembly 32 extending out of the second opening 1111b can be used to cut the printing material that has completed pattern printing.

[0089] Please refer to Figures 6 to 9 In the embodiments of the utility model, the cutter assembly 32 includes a frame body 321 and a cutter 322, one end of the frame body 321 is in transmission connection with the driving mechanism 31, and the cutter 322 is arranged at one end of the frame body 321 away from the driving mechanism 31 and is detachably connected with the frame body 321.

[0090] The frame body 321 is used as a fixing structure for mounting the cutter 322, and can be in transmission connection with the driving mechanism 31, so that the cutter 322 can be driven to extend and retract relative to the second opening 1111b under the driving of the driving mechanism 31. Since the cutter 322 is detachably connected with the frame body 321, and the cutter assembly 32 is arranged opposite to the second opening 1111b, the user can assemble or disassemble the cutter 322 to or from the frame body 321 through the second opening 1111b without disassembling the machine shell 10, so that the disassembly and assembly convenience of the cutter 322 is improved.

[0091] In the embodiment, the frame body 321 can further be provided with a limiting groove 3211, and part of the cutter 322 can be inserted into the limiting groove 3211, so that the limiting effect of the limiting groove 3211 on the cutter 322 can realize quick positioning of the cutter 322 and the frame body 321, and the connection stability between the cutter 322 and the frame body 321 can be improved.

[0092] In the embodiment of the utility model, frame body 321 is equipped with installation site, cutter assembly 32 still includes magnetic attraction piece 324, magnetic attraction piece 324 is equipped with installation site, with cutter 322 magnetic attraction cooperation, and / or, cutter assembly 32 still includes fastener 325, installation site is equipped with the fastening hole of fastener 325 threading, to make cutter 322 lock in frame body 321 by fastener 325.

[0093] It should be noted that the cutter 322 can be detachably connected with the frame body 321 only through magnetic attraction cooperation, for example, the cutter 322 can be directly magnetically attracted and cooperated with the magnetic attraction piece 324 arranged at the installation site, or the end of the cutter 322 facing the frame body 321 can also be provided with another magnetic attraction piece 324, so as to magnetically attract and cooperate the two magnetic attraction pieces to mount the cutter to the frame body 321. Alternatively, the cutter 322 can also be locked to the frame body 321 only through the fastener 325, wherein the fastener 325 can be configured as a bolt, the fastening hole can be configured as a threaded hole, and the fastener 325 can penetrate the cutter 322 and be threadedly connected with the frame body 321 to lock the cutter 322 to the frame body 321. Of course, the cutter 322 can also be detachably mounted to the frame body 321 through other ways, which are not limited herein. Further, in some embodiments, the cutter 322 can also be mounted to the frame body 321 through two or more kinds of detachable connection modes at the same time, for example, the cutter 322 can be further locked on the frame body 321 through the fastener 325 on the basis of being magnetically connected with the frame body 321, so that the connection stability between the frame body 321 and the cutter 322 can be further improved.

[0094] Please refer to Figure 8In the embodiment of the utility model, the cutter assembly 32 further comprises a material pressing piece 323, the material pressing piece 323 is arranged on one side of the cutter assembly 32, when the cutter assembly 32 is in the extended state, the material pressing piece 323 extends out of the second opening 1111b, and the material pressing piece 323 is used for pressing the printing material.

[0095] It can be understood that by arranging the material pressing piece 323 on one side of the cutter assembly 32, when the cutter 322 cuts the printing material, the material pressing piece 323 can press the printing material from the side of the cutter 322 through the outer peripheral surface thereof, so as to avoid the printing material from being lifted to affect the cutting effect of the cutter assembly 32 on the printing material.

[0096] Further, in the embodiment of the utility model, the cutter assembly 32 comprises a frame body 321 and a cutter 322, and the material pressing piece 323 and the cutter 322 are arranged side by side on the frame body 321. In this way, on the one hand, the material pressing piece 323 can be arranged adjacent to the cutter 322, so that the material pressing piece 323 can have a good pressing effect on the part of the printing material to be cut when the cutter 322 cuts the printing material; on the other hand, the cutter 322 and the material pressing piece 323 can be connected into an integral structure through the frame body 321, so that only one driving mechanism 31 is needed to drive the frame body 321 to move relative to the second opening 1111b, and the cutter 322 and the material pressing piece 323 can be driven to move synchronously relative to the second opening 1111b.

[0097] In the embodiment, the side wall of the frame body 321 can be provided with a surrounding edge structure 3212, the surrounding edge structure 3212 is arranged at one end of the material pressing piece 323 away from the second opening 1111b and surrounds the side of the material pressing piece 323, so that the side wall of the surrounding edge structure 3212 and the outer peripheral surface of the material pressing piece 323 can be limited and matched to realize quick positioning of the material pressing piece 323 and the frame body 321, and the connection stability between the material pressing piece 323 and the frame body 321 can be improved.

[0108] Referring to Figures 1 to 5 In an embodiment of the utility model, two first pass openings 1111a are arranged on the working surface 1111 at intervals, the printing module 20 is provided with two, each printing module 20 is arranged corresponding to a first pass opening 1111a, and the cutter module 30 is arranged between the two printing modules 20, or the cutter module 30 is arranged on the side of one printing module 20 away from the other printing module 20.

[0109] In this embodiment, the inkjet printing device can be a white ink ironing printing machine, which usually adopts DTF ink composed of CMYK four colors and white. Correspondingly, the print head 100 is provided with two printing modules 20, one of which is a color ink printing module for realizing the color ink printing function corresponding to CMYK four colors, and the other is a white ink printing module for realizing the white ink printing function. During use, the print head 100 can first print a color pattern on the printing material through one of the printing modules 20, and then print a layer of white ink on the color pattern through the other printing module 20. In this way, the color of the color pattern obtained by printing white ink on the printing material can be more vivid.

[0110] Optionally, in an embodiment, the two printing modules 20 are arranged at intervals, and the cutter module 30 can be arranged at a position between the two printing modules 20. In use, after the color ink printing module and the white ink printing module complete the pattern printing in sequence, the cutter module 30 can be switched from the retracted state to the extended state, and moved to a specific position relative to the printing material, so as to cut the printing material.

[0111] In another embodiment, the two printing modules 20 can also be arranged closely, and the cutter module 30 can be arranged on a side of each cutter module 30 away from another cutter module 30. For example, the color ink printing module, the white ink printing module, and the cutter module 30 are arranged in sequence along the transmission direction of the printing material. In this way, the printing material can be docked with the color ink printing module, the white ink printing module, and the cutter module 30 in sequence during the transmission process, so as to complete the color ink printing, the white ink printing, and the printing material segmentation in sequence. Moreover, after the printing material completes the pattern printing and the printing material segmentation, it still needs to be transferred to the baking machine or the curing machine for the subsequent printing material drying step. Since the inkjet printing device and the baking machine or the curing machine generally connect in sequence along the transmission direction of the printing material, the color ink printing module, the white ink printing module, and the cutter module 30 arranged in sequence along the transmission direction of the printing material also facilitate the transfer of the segmented printing material to the baking machine or the curing machine.

[0120] Please refer to Figures 1 to 5 In the embodiment of the utility model, the shell 10 further includes a mounting piece 13, one end of the mounting piece 13 is arranged on the side of the main shell 11 away from the connecting piece 12, and the other end extends in the direction away from the main shell 11; the print head 100 further includes a camera module 50, and the camera module 50 is mounted on the mounting piece 13.

[0121] It can be understood that by arranging the camera module 50 on the print head 100, the printing path of the print head 100 can be photographed, whether the printing path of the print head 100 is a straight line can be detected, and the printing position of the print head 100 can be further calibrated based on the detection result, thereby being beneficial to guarantee the printing quality of the print head 100.

[0122] In an embodiment of the present application, the mounting piece 13 and the connecting piece 12 are arranged on opposite sides of the main shell 11, the connecting piece 12 is in transmission connection with an external driving device, and the external driving device can drive the print head 100 to move in the direction perpendicular to the arrangement direction of the mounting piece 13 and the connecting piece 12. This kind of arrangement mode can reduce the volume of the print head 100 in the direction perpendicular to the arrangement direction of the mounting piece 13 and the connecting piece 12, so that the print head 100 can have sufficient space for moving and loading.

[0124] In the embodiment of the present application, at least part of the main shell 11 is made of plastic material. It should be noted that in the related art, the material of the casing 10 of the print head 100 is usually sheet metal. Compared with this, the technical scheme of the present application is that at least part of the main shell 11 is made of plastic material, which is beneficial to reduce the weight of the casing 10, so as to facilitate the driving of the print head 100 by the external driving device, and to provide more margin for the speed adjustment of the print head 100. Moreover, the selection of plastic material is also beneficial to reduce the manufacturing cost of the casing 10.

[0125] In the embodiment of the present application, the connecting piece 12 is made of sheet metal. In the inkjet printing device, the print head 100 is connected to the external driving device through the connecting piece 12 of the casing 10, so that the weight of the print head 100 is mainly supported by the connecting piece 12. By setting the material of the connecting piece 12 as sheet metal, the structural strength of the connecting piece 12 can be ensured, thereby ensuring the structural stability of the inkjet printing device.

[0126] Please refer to Figures 10 to 11 In the embodiment of the present application, the printing module 20 comprises an inkjet mechanism 21, an ink supply mechanism 22 and a leakage prevention mechanism. The inkjet mechanism 21 is arranged on the first opening 1111a. The ink supply mechanism 22 is detachably connected with the inkjet mechanism 21 to supply ink to the inkjet mechanism 21. The leakage prevention mechanism is connected between the inkjet mechanism 21 and the ink supply mechanism 22 to prevent the ink in the ink supply mechanism 22 from leaking out when the ink supply mechanism 22 is separated from the inkjet mechanism 21.

[0127] The ink supply mechanism 22 can be a color ink supply mechanism, such as a color ink cartridge, or a white ink supply mechanism, such as a white ink cartridge. The ink ejection mechanism 21 can be configured as a printhead for printing ink provided by the ink cartridge on a printing material in a manner of inkjet printing.

[0128] In an embodiment of the present application, the ink supply mechanism 22 and the ink ejection mechanism 21 can be connected through plug-in cooperation, so that the ink supply mechanism 22 and the ink ejection mechanism 21 can be quickly plugged and unplugged, improving the assembly convenience of the printing module 20. Of course, the ink supply mechanism 22 and the ink ejection mechanism 21 can also be detachably connected through snap connection, threaded connection, or other manners, which are not limited herein.

[0129] It should be noted that in a printing module 20, the ink supply mechanism 22 can be provided with multiple ink supply mechanisms 22 connected side by side on the ink ejection mechanism 21. To improve the connection stability between the ink supply mechanism and the ink ejection mechanism 21, the ink ejection mechanism 21 can be provided with multiple positioning grooves 211, which are shaped in imitation of the ink ejection mechanism 21, and each positioning groove 211 is used for limiting cooperation with an ink ejection mechanism 21. Of course, the ink ejection mechanism 21 can also limit the ink supply mechanism 22 through other positioning structures, which are not limited herein. The number of printheads in the ink ejection mechanism 21 can be consistent with the ink supply mechanism 22.

[0130] The ink supply mechanism and the ink ejection mechanism 21 are detachably connected, that is, the ink supply mechanism can be separated and removed after being installed on the ink ejection mechanism 21, so as to facilitate the maintenance and replacement of the structures of the printing module 20. On this basis, by connecting the leakage prevention mechanism between the ink ejection mechanism 21 and the ink supply mechanism 22, it can be avoided that when the leakage prevention mechanism is detached from the ink ejection mechanism 21, the ink in the ink supply mechanism 22 leaks outwardly and directly enters the accommodation cavity, causing pollution to other structures of the printhead 100.

[0131] The leakage prevention mechanism can be specifically configured as a leakage prevention valve, which is opened when the ink supply mechanism is connected with the ink ejection mechanism 21 to make the ink path of the ink supply mechanism 22 and the ink ejection mechanism 21 communicate, and is closed when the ink supply mechanism is disconnected from the ink ejection mechanism 21 to stop the ink supply mechanism 22 from discharging ink outwardly.

[0132] In a feasible implementation, the inkjet printing device can be a white ink ironing printer. Correspondingly, among the two printing modules 20 of the print head 100, one printing module 20 is provided with four ink supply mechanisms 22, which are specifically configured as four color ink cartridges corresponding to CMYK four colors; the other printing module 20 can also be provided with four ink supply mechanisms 22, and the four ink supply mechanisms 22 are all white ink cartridges. In use, the print head 100 can first print a color pattern on the printing material through one printing module 20, and then print a layer of white ink on the color pattern through the other printing module 20. In this way, the color of the color pattern obtained by printing can be made more vivid by printing white ink on the printing material.

[0133] Further, in some embodiments, when the four ink supply mechanisms 22 in the printing module 20 are all white ink cartridges, the four white ink cartridges can adopt a four-in-one design, that is, the four white ink cartridges are connected to form an integrated structure. In this way, the four white ink cartridges can be disassembled and assembled as a whole with the inkjet mechanism 21, which is conducive to improving the structural integration and disassembly convenience of the printing module 20.

[0134] Please refer to Figure 2 and Figure 10 In some embodiments, the printing module 20 further includes a conversion board 23, which can be electrically connected with the inkjet mechanism 21, and the input interface of the conversion board 23 can be electrically connected with the main board 40. The conversion board 23 can be connected with multiple inkjet heads in the inkjet mechanism 21, so that when the printing module 20 is assembled, only one wire needs to be connected between the main board 40 and the conversion board 23, and multiple wires are not needed to connect the main board and multiple inkjet heads, which is more convenient for wiring and simpler for assembly.

[0135] Please refer to Figure 1 and Figure 2 In the embodiments of the present application, the print head 100 further includes an anti-collision mechanism 60, which is arranged on the casing 10 and is used to prevent the casing 10 from being externally collided. It can be understood that by arranging the anti-collision mechanism 60 on the print head 100 to prevent the casing 10 from being externally collided, the safety of the print head 100 can be improved.

[0136] The anti-collision mechanism 60 can be arranged on the side of the casing 10 to avoid collision between the outer side wall of the print head 100 and the external structure. For example, the print head 100 can move in the first direction, and the anti-collision mechanism 60 can be arranged on the opposite sides of the print head 100 in the first direction, so as to avoid the risk of collision between the casing 10 and the external structure when the print head 100 moves in the first direction. Alternatively, the anti-collision mechanism 60 can also be arranged on the bottom of the casing 10 to avoid collision between the printing surface at the bottom of the print head 100 and the external structure, and thus achieve the effect of preventing hand pinching. Alternatively, the anti-collision mechanism 60 can also be arranged on the side and bottom of the casing 10 to improve the comprehensiveness of the protection of the print head 100. Of course, the anti-collision mechanism 60 can also be used to achieve the anti-collision function of other positions of the casing 10. The number of anti-collision mechanisms 60 arranged on the casing 10 can be one, two or more. That is, the application does not limit the arrangement position and number of the anti-collision mechanism 60.

[0137] Further, when the anti-collision mechanism 60 is arranged on the side and bottom of the casing 10, the anti-collision mechanisms 60 arranged on the side and bottom of the casing 10 can be integrated and arranged as a whole. In this way, the number of parts on the print head 100 can be reduced, so as to improve the structural integration and assembly efficiency of the print head 100.

[0138] In an embodiment, the anti-collision mechanism 60 can be arranged on the casing 10 of the print head 100 and at least partially protrude from the outer surface of the casing 10. In this way, during the movement of the print head 100, the anti-collision mechanism 60 can detect whether it is in contact with the external structure by contact detection, for example, the anti-collision mechanism 60 can be configured as a pressure sensor or other contact detection mechanism. Since the anti-collision mechanism 60 protrudes from the outer surface of the casing 10, it can contact the external structure before the casing 10, so that the casing 10 can be stopped in time when the anti-collision mechanism 60 is triggered to avoid collision between the casing 10 and the external structure due to excessive movement.

[0139] Alternatively, in another embodiment, the anti-collision mechanism 60 can also detect the distance between the anti-collision mechanism 60 and the external structure by non-contact detection, for example, the anti-collision mechanism 60 can be configured as an infrared distance sensor or other non-contact detection mechanism. In this way, the casing 10 can be stopped in time when it is detected that the distance between the anti-collision mechanism 60 and the external structure is too close, so as to avoid collision between the casing 10 and the external structure due to excessive movement.
